Everyone looked at me wierd when I told them I was getting a Computer Science BS degree along with my Vocal Performance BFA degree. > Just curious, is the XX-7 OS written in C, assembler or what? What > is the development platform? I understand the ColdFire is a distant > relative of the MC68000. Mostly C++. The Coldfire is actually a pretty close relative of the 68k with a bunch more features that make it more of a standalone CPU. > Will there be more sophisticated editing functions?
